How long did it take for the Thirteenth Amendment to be ratified by state legislatures after it was passed by Congress?

History
2 answers:
snow_tiger [21]3 years ago
8 0

Answer:

less than a year

Explanation:

It took less than year for the Thirteenth Amendment to be ratified by state legislatures after it was passed by Congress.

Which of the four North African states that made up the Barbary States is missing from the list below? Tangier, Algiers, Tripoli
BaLLatris [955]
The Barbary states was the name of the four North African states: Tangier, Algiers, Tripoli and Tunis, from 16th through 19th century. The name comes from the Berber people, who were living in that area.
Answer: The missing state is Tunis .

What is a landform consists of an area of land enclosed by higher land such as
Katarina [22]

Answer:

Basins

Explanation:

A basin landform consists of an area of land, usually like a smaller prairie, enclosed by higher land such as hills and mountains. A basin does not have to consist of lowland like a prairie. It can consist of land such as a desert or even an arctic desert.
